Impact of exclusive breastfeeding on physical growth
Summary: Background: Breastfeeding is considered the gold standard in infant feeding, as it provides ideal nutrition for infants. Both the World Health Organization (2016) and the American Academy of Pediatrics (2012) recommend exclusive breastfeeding from birth until 6 months of life.Aim: To inves...
